Happiness is a beautiful feeling… but a terrible thing to chase.
It comes and goes.
It depends on things going right.
It asks life to cooperate before it shows up.
And if you live that way, you stay stuck—
waiting, adjusting, negotiating with reality…
telling yourself “once this happens, then I’ll be okay.”
That’s exhausting.
Peace is different.
Peace doesn’t wait.
It doesn’t need perfect timing or perfect people.
It’s quiet, steady… and at first, unfamiliar.
Especially if you’ve been used to chaos.
Because when things finally get calm,
it can feel like something’s missing—
but what’s actually gone is the version of you
that was always bracing, chasing, proving.
Happiness says:
“Give me something good, and I’ll show up.”
Peace says:
“I’ll stay, even when things aren’t.”
And here’s the truth most people don’t tell you:
It’s been you all along.
You were the one holding yourself together
when no one checked in.
You were the one who kept going
when it would’ve been easier to stop.
You were the one who learned, adjusted, healed… quietly.
Not them. Not circumstances. You.
So when you choose peace,
you stop begging life to feel better—
and you start becoming someone who is better, from within.
You walk away sooner.
You say no without guilt.
You stop trying to force love where it doesn’t exist.
Your life may look simpler—
but it feels real.
And the irony?
When you stop chasing happiness,
it starts finding you… more often.
Not because you ran after it,
but because you finally became a place
where it feels safe to stay.
It was never out there.
It was you. 🖤

Hey, listen to your emotions… 🤍
✨ Bitterness shows you where you need to heal—where you’re still holding judgments on others and yourself.
✨ Resentment shows you where you’re living in the past and not allowing the present to be as it is.
✨ Discomfort shows you that it’s time to pay attention—because you’re being invited to grow and do something different.
✨ Anger shows you what you’re passionate about, where your boundaries are, and what you believe needs to change.
✨ Disappointment shows you that you tried, that you still care, and that you didn’t give in to apathy.
✨ Guilt shows you where you’re still living by other people’s expectations.
✨ Shame shows you where you’ve internalized others’ beliefs about who you should be—and reminds you to reconnect with yourself.
✨ Anxiety shows you that it’s time to come back to the present, instead of living in fear of the future or stuck in the past.
✨ Sadness shows you the depth of your heart and how deeply you care.
🌱 And honestly… envy shows you what you want, but think you can’t have.
✨ There is enough for everyone. ✨
